    I was on vacation this past week, but managed to catch up on a few things and catch the premiere of a couple others:

    • Apothecary Diaries - Finished this season up and really liked it. I think I liked the first season better, but I would be hard pressed to point to a show that managed to pull off 48 episodes of as consistently good quality as this one. Looking forward to season 3 eventually.
    • Slime 300 - I caught up on this one and powered through the end of the season. It’s more of the same, just with some new moe characters. I had fun.
    • Rock is a Lady’s Modesty - I enjoyed the finale, but I kind of doubt this is getting another season. I will have to wait for the manga translations to catch the rest of the story.
    • Vending Machine Isekai - Boxxo is back and it picks up right where things left off. I wasn’t sure what to expect with a season two of this premise, but a three-story tall ice vending machine wasn’t it. This show remains as creative as ever.
    • Dan Da Dan - Speaking of picking up right where things left off… Good first episode back and remains as unhinged as ever. I never expected a Jennifer Lopez in Anaconda reference. I am pretty sure Dan Da Dan’s primary audience was probably born after that movie came out.
    • Silent Witch - Good first episode and better production quality than I was expecting (plus easily the best Villainess of the season). Looking forward to the change in setting from episode 2 onwards.
    • New Saga - I read the manga for this one and I think I am going to drop the anime. If you watched the premiere and thought that you have seen this story before, it’s likely that you have since the LNs came out over a decade ago when it might not have felt as derivative.
